Transaction 4651d20525313e1077db6869072c9ed1ba3728cf02e2a09ca1e3a590bbbaf2e6
1 Input
1 Output
-
4651d20525313e1077db6869072c9ed1ba3728cf02e2a09ca1e3a590bbbaf2e6:0
- value
- 44124257
- script pubkey
- OP_0 OP_PUSHBYTES_20 567574d5c29b5d94eda267689878a4e03b924e5f
- address
- bc1q2e6hf4wzndwefmdzva5fs79yuqaeynjlay6mvt